hydric

Syllabification: (hy·dric)
Pronunciation: /ˈhīdrik/
Definition of hydric

adjective

Ecology
  • (of an environment or habitat) containing plenty of moisture; very wet. Compare with mesic1 and xeric.

Origin:

early 20th century: from hydro- + -ic
